New website of the TETRA Association now live!

Source: The Critical Communications Review | Gert Jan Wolf editor

Phi Kidner: "I believe that it is important to offer the browsing experience that can be expected from an international organization like the TETRA Association”

Today and according to plan the new website of the TETRA Association went live. Over the last years the TETRA Association has grown enormously and with this, also the amount of information that can be found on their website. Enough reasons to refresh the Association's website.

According to Phil Kidner: "I believe that it is important to offer the browsing experience that can be expected from an international organization like the TETRA Association”.

The menu structure of the new website provides offers a clear overview of the different pages that can be visited and if you want to find more detailed information, at the bottom of the website you will find a wide variety of links that leads you to more detailed information such as TETRA Today, and overview of previous events, information about interoperability, press releases, the TETRA pocket guide, certificates, regional forum’s ,etc. Some of this information also can be found back on the left side of the website pages

Overall, the website looks crystal clear  and the information needed can be found more easily as compared to the old website.
